California Institute of Integral Studies is a small four-year, private not-for-profit school with 2,145 students enrolled. This school was founded in 1968 and is one of the 15 schools and colleges located in
San Francisco,
California.
Academic Offerings
California Institute of Integral Studies will give you the opportunity to obtain a bachelor's degree, postbaccalaureate certificate, master's degree, or doctoral degree.
California Institute of Integral Studies follows a semester-based curriculum calendar system and lets you to select from 13 majors. The most popular concentrations are Psychology, Medical, General Studies, Philosophy, and Theology and Religion. Read the details about

Tuition and Loans
Average tuition price is high, $21,200 per year. The additional fees at California Institute of Integral Studies (not included in tuition costs) are approximately $500, which comes to a total of $21,700 a year.

Admissions Information
The school might accept credits for life experience (learned through independent study, noncredit adult courses, work experience, portfolio demonstration, previous licensure or certification, or completion of other learning opportunities) and advanced placement credits (college-level courses taught in high school) at entry.
The undergraduate application fee at California Institute of Integral Studies is $65.00. The graduate application fee is $65.00.

California Institute of Integral Studies provides a distance education program, study abroad programs, and evening/weekend study opportunity, which is a great option for those who work full-time.
There are options for on-campus part-time employment at California Institute of Integral Studies, which allows students to cover some of the tuition expenses. Additionally, this school helps students to evaluate their career options and find a full-time job upon graduation.
Presently there is no on-campus housing at California Institute of Integral Studies.
